Overview and History of Claremont Dallas Homes
Explore the charm of ‘Claremont Dallas Homes,’ a notable area in Dallas, Texas, known for its rich history dating back to the 1950s and 1960s. Once a hub for dairy and cotton farming, this region has significantly contributed to Dallas’s agricultural scene. As Dallas has grown, the area known for Claremont Dallas Homes has evolved into a warm, close-knit community, blending its historical roots with modern living.
The establishment of the Claremont Addition Neighborhood Association/CrimeWatch 1199 in 1994 marked a pivotal moment in the neighborhood’s history. This initiative was driven by the collective need to address rising crime and to instill a sense of community and civic pride among the residents. Since its inception, the association has been pivotal in focusing on improving the quality of life, promoting economic vitality, and reducing crime. Their efforts have positively impacted the neighborhood, fostering a close-knit community that thrives on togetherness and shared experiences. Additionally, the association actively supports public safety measures and organizes a wide array of community-wide events, creating a vibrant and welcoming environment for all residents.

Community Lifestyle and Amenities
Claremont is known for its vibrant lifestyle and varied amenities. The Claremont Addition Neighborhood Association/CrimeWatch 1199, established in 1994, boosts community pride and tackles crime. It organizes events like the National Night Out CANA Block Party, wine walks, and beautification projects. These activities foster a close community feel.
Furthermore, the neighborhood’s emphasis on outdoor activities and regular neighborhood events reflects the residents’ commitment to fostering a strong sense of community and engagement. For instance, the annual Easter Egg Hunts organized by the Claremont Addition Neighborhood Association bring families together for a day of fun and bonding, adding to the neighborhood’s family-friendly environment and facilitating opportunities for social interaction among neighbors. These events not only promote community spirit but also create lasting memories for families and individuals within the neighborhood.
